The chicken nugget vs chicken popcorn debate has divided chicken enthusiasts for years. While both are delectable morsels of breaded poultry, they differ in several key aspects:

  • Size and Shape: Chicken nuggets are typically larger and have a rectangular shape, while chicken popcorn is smaller and irregularly shaped.
  • Breading: Chicken nuggets have a thicker, crunchier breading, while chicken popcorn has a lighter, flakier coating.
  • Flavor: Chicken nuggets often have a more seasoned flavor, while chicken popcorn tends to be milder.

Which One Is Better: Chicken Nuggets or Chicken Popcorn?

The answer to this question is subjective and depends on personal preference. However, here are some factors to consider:

Taste and Texture

Chicken nuggets offer a more substantial bite with a satisfying crunch. Chicken popcorn, on the other hand, provides a lighter, airier experience with a subtle crispiness.

Size and Quantity

Chicken nuggets are larger and come in fewer pieces, making them ideal for a quick snack or meal. Chicken popcorn is smaller and comes in larger quantities, perfect for sharing or munching on.

Versatility

Chicken nuggets can be paired with a variety of dipping sauces, while chicken popcorn can be used as a topping for salads or soups.

Health Considerations

Chicken nuggets tend to be higher in calories and fat than chicken popcorn due to their thicker breading. However, both options can be enjoyed in moderation as part of a balanced diet.

How to Cook Chicken Nuggets and Chicken Popcorn

Both chicken nuggets and chicken popcorn can be cooked in a variety of ways:

  • Frying: Pan-frying or deep-frying provides the crispiest results.
  • Baking: Baking in the oven is a healthier alternative that still yields a satisfying crunch.
  • Air Frying: Air fryers offer a crispy, low-fat cooking method.
